PC World is one of the biggest chains of computer and electronics stores in Britain. The first store was opened in Croydon in
late 1991, and has been expanding since. There are more than a hundred and fifty stores throughout the UK and in Ireland. Sales have topped 1,600
million in just one recent fiscal year.
PC World offers a wide range of laptops, PCs, peripherals and other electronics. You can buy components there, case, as well
as mobile phones. However, for such a large store, the selection available when it comes to PC World mobile phones is a little disappointing.
A search for the word "mobile" on PC World's website turns up only two options, both BlackBerry products. For £249.99, you can
purchase the BlackBerry 8100 Handheld Computer. It includes a digital camera, web browser, expandable memory, instant and text messaging,
organizer applications, and mobile phone capabilities.
This mobile phone comes with the BlackBerry operating system, 64 Mb of internal flash memory, an integrated QWERTY key board
and a 240x260 display. AThe build in mp3 and mp4 player allow access to media on the go. The included battery will last for up to twenty-two days
on standby, and a micro SD memory card reader and speakers are integrated into the slim, light design.
For a little more - £349.99, you can purchase the BlackBerry 8800 Handheld Computer, which offers many of the same features as
the above phone, but with some improvements. The screen is larger, with a 320x240 colour display, and the phone includes Bluetooth capabilities.
GPS is also included.
